townland
Tobar na Sceiche
genitive: Thobar na Sceiche
validated name (What is this?)
(Irish)
Thornwell
(English)

Glossary

sceach, sceich
English hawthorn, thorn-bush
English well

Historical references

1739
part of Lenamarran now called Knock and Thornwell san Thornhill (innéacs, leis).
CGn. Imleabhar: 99.87.68066
1743
Knock and Thornhill
RD Wills Leathanach: I, 302.693
1744
Thornwell
CGn. Imleabhar: 115.282.80459
1763
Thornwell or Mount Wilson
CGn. Imleabhar: 228.221.150051
1763
Thornhill
CGn. Imleabhar: 99.index
1801
Thornwell
CGn. Imleabhar: 533.395.354483
1805
Thronwell
CGn. Imleabhar: 577.309.387155
1812
Knock and Thorn-well
"part of Lenamarran now called K. and T.
CGn. Imleabhar: 99.87.68066
1812
Thornwell T.L.
Leet Leathanach: 231
1837
Thornwell
BS:AL
1837
Thorn Well
CM:AL
1837
Thornwell
Hewson Map 1785:AL
